Cleaning and care

To better maintain your appliance avoid the following:

Never use a steam cleaner to clean this cooktop.
Pressurized steam could cause permanent damage to the
surface and to components.
Do not use any sharp or pointed objects which could
damage the seal between the frame and the countertop.
Keep the ignitor in the burner dry. If it gets wet it will not
spark.
Dry your cooktop thoroughly after cleaning it to prevent
lime deposits.
Spills containing salt or sugar should be cleaned immedi-
ately.
The surfaces of the burner parts and grates become
slightly duller over time. This is normal and does not
indicate any impairment of the material.
– cleaners containing soda, ammonia, thinners, or chlorides,
– cleaners containing descaling agents or lime removers,
– abrasive cleaners,
– stainless steel cleaners,
– dishwasher soap,
– caustic (oven) cleaners,
– scouring pads, steel wool, hard brushes,
– metal scrapers.
Glass cleaners may be used to clean the exterior.
However do not allow them to sit or "puddle", this can
cause damage to the surface. Remove the cleaner
promptly.
